Description

Summary
The Rotary Press provides cost-effective continuous dewatering of a wide range of sludges using pressure differential and frictional resistance at a rotational speed below 1 rpm. The compact, pre-assembled unit is designed for low maintenance and low energy consumption.

Description
The Rotary Press uses a low rotational speed (<1 rpm) to develop a pressure differential and frictional resistance that effectively dewaters various sludge types. Continuous operation and a simple mechanical design reduce wear and energy demand. The unit is fully enclosed and supplied pre-assembled to facilitate rapid installation and commissioning. Typical applications include municipal and industrial sludge dewatering where reliable solids capture and quality filtrate are required.

Model variants & typical specifications
  • RFP2.0-24S: 24 in / 61 cm single channel – filtration area ~27.6 cm² – flow 5–15 GPM
  • RFP2.0-36S: 36 in / 91.4 cm single channel – filtration area ~66.5 cm² – flow 20–35 GPM
  • RFP2.0-36D: 36 in / 91.4 cm double channel – filtration area ~133.2 cm² – flow 40–70 GPM
  • RFP2.0-48S: 48 in / 121.9 cm single channel – filtration area ~121.4 cm² – flow 35–65 GPM
  • RFP2.0-48D: 48 in / 121.9 cm double channel – filtration area ~242.8 cm² – flow 70–130 GPM
  • FP2.0-48Q: 48 in / 121.9 cm quadruple channel – filtration area ~485.7 cm² – flow 140–260 GPM
